We use evolutionary algorithms to design photonic crystal structures with large band gaps. Starting from randomly generated photonic crystals, the algorithm yielded a photonic crystal with a band gap (defined as the gap to midgap ratio) as large as 0.3189. This band gap is an improvement of 12.5% over the best human design using the same index contrast platform.
